怎么看财务软件用得什么数据库
-
选择财务软件所使用的数据库是一个重要的决策,它会直接影响到软件的性能、安全性、可扩展性等方面。以下是判断财务软件使用何种数据库的几个关键因素:
-
数据量和性能要求:财务软件通常需要处理大量的数据,因此选择一个能够高效处理大规模数据的数据库是关键。一些常见的关系型数据库如Oracle、MySQL、SQL Server等都能够满足一般财务软件的需求。如果数据量非常庞大,可以考虑使用分布式数据库或者列式数据库。
-
数据安全性要求:财务数据的安全性至关重要,因此选择具有强大安全特性的数据库是必要的。数据库应该支持数据加密、访问控制、审计日志等功能,以防止敏感数据的泄露和未经授权的访问。
-
数据一致性和可靠性:财务软件需要保证数据的一致性和可靠性,因此选择一个具备事务处理和容错能力的数据库是必要的。数据库应该支持ACID事务特性,并能够提供高可用性和容错机制,如备份和恢复功能。
-
可扩展性和灵活性:财务软件的业务规模可能会不断扩大,因此选择一个能够支持水平扩展和垂直扩展的数据库是重要的。数据库应该能够轻松地处理增加的负载,并具备灵活的数据模型和查询语言,以适应业务需求的变化。
-
成本考量:数据库的选择还应考虑成本因素。开源数据库如MySQL和PostgreSQL通常具有较低的成本,而商业数据库如Oracle和SQL Server则需要支付许可费用。此外,还需要考虑数据库的维护和支持成本。
综上所述,选择财务软件所使用的数据库需要综合考虑数据量和性能要求、数据安全性要求、数据一致性和可靠性、可扩展性和灵活性以及成本等因素。根据具体的业务需求和预算限制,选择最适合的数据库,以确保财务软件的正常运行和数据安全。
3个月前 -
-
要确定财务软件使用的数据库,可以考虑以下几个因素:
-
软件的需求和功能:不同的财务软件有不同的功能和需求,这也会影响其选择使用的数据库。例如,一些财务软件可能需要处理大量的数据并进行复杂的计算和分析,需要使用性能较好的数据库。而一些小型的财务软件可能只需要存储和管理简单的数据,可以选择较为简单和轻量级的数据库。
-
数据库的性能和可扩展性:财务软件通常需要处理大量的数据,而且需要保证数据的安全性和可靠性。因此,选择具有良好性能和可扩展性的数据库非常重要。例如,一些常见的关系型数据库(如MySQL、Oracle)通常具有较好的性能和可扩展性,可以满足大部分财务软件的需求。
-
数据库的安全性:财务软件处理的是涉及财务数据的敏感信息,因此数据库的安全性也是非常重要的考虑因素。一些数据库提供了强大的安全功能,如访问控制、数据加密等,可以帮助保护财务数据的安全。
-
开发和维护成本:选择数据库还需要考虑开发和维护的成本。一些数据库可能需要额外的许可费用,而一些开源数据库则可以减少成本。此外,还要考虑数据库的易用性和开发人员的熟悉程度,以确保能够高效地开发和维护财务软件。
总之,选择财务软件使用的数据库需要综合考虑软件需求和功能、数据库的性能和可扩展性、安全性以及开发和维护成本等因素。最终的选择应该是基于对这些因素的权衡和实际需求的分析。
3个月前 -
-
选择合适的数据库对于财务软件的开发和使用非常重要。一个好的数据库应该能够提供高效的数据存储和访问能力,保证数据的安全性和完整性。在选择财务软件所使用的数据库时,可以考虑以下几个因素:
-
数据库类型:常见的数据库类型包括关系型数据库(如MySQL、Oracle、SQL Server等)和非关系型数据库(如MongoDB、Redis等)。关系型数据库适合处理结构化数据,非关系型数据库适合处理半结构化和非结构化数据。根据财务软件的需求和数据特点,选择合适的数据库类型。
-
数据库性能:财务软件通常需要处理大量的数据,因此数据库的性能非常重要。性能指标包括读写速度、并发能力、扩展性等。可以参考各个数据库的性能测试结果和压力测试报告,选择性能较好的数据库。
-
数据库安全性:财务软件的数据往往包含敏感信息,如财务报表、客户资料等。因此,数据库的安全性是一个重要考虑因素。数据库应该提供用户认证和授权机制,支持数据加密和数据备份等功能。
-
数据库可靠性:财务软件需要保证数据的完整性和可靠性。数据库应该提供事务管理和数据一致性保证机制,支持数据的备份和恢复。此外,数据库的容灾和高可用性能也是一个重要因素。
-
数据库成本:财务软件的开发和运维成本也是一个重要考虑因素。不同的数据库提供商有不同的授权和许可方式,价格也有差异。应该根据财务软件的需求和预算,选择成本适中的数据库。
在选择数据库时,可以进行一些测试和评估,比如创建一些模拟的财务数据,测试数据库的读写速度和性能;参考一些行业标准和案例,了解其他财务软件所使用的数据库类型和经验;咨询专业的数据库管理员或开发人员,获取他们的建议和意见。
总之,选择合适的数据库对于财务软件的开发和使用非常重要。应该综合考虑数据库的类型、性能、安全性、可靠性和成本等因素,选择最适合财务软件需求的数据库。
3个月前 -